perf probe: Fix to show which probe point is not found

Fix perf probe to show which probe point is not found.
With out this patch, it shows just "No probe point found."
This doesn't help users if they specify several probes.
e.g.

 # perf probe -f --add schedule --add test
  Fatal: No probe point found.

This patch makes error message more helpful as below.

 # perf probe --add schedule --add test
  Fatal: Probe point 'test' not found. - probe not added.
